400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el公式为什么不叠加

作者:路由通
|
55人看过
发布时间:2025-11-01 04:23:02
标签:
电子表格软件中公式不叠加的现象常困扰使用者,这源于程序设计的底层逻辑限制。本文通过12个关键维度解析该问题,涵盖单元格引用机制、函数嵌套规则、循环引用陷阱等核心技术原理,并结合实际案例演示正确解决方案。文章将深入探讨公式计算优先级、数据类型冲突等常见误区,为使用者提供系统性的排查方法和优化策略,帮助从根本上掌握电子表格公式的应用技巧。
excel公式为什么不叠加

       公式计算机制的本质特征

       电子表格软件的设计遵循"单结果导向"原则,每个单元格仅能保留一个最终计算结果。当使用者尝试在已有公式的单元格继续输入新公式时,系统会默认覆盖原有内容而非进行叠加运算。这种设计源于早期电子表格软件的内存管理机制,现代版本虽已增强计算能力,但基础逻辑仍保持向下兼容。例如在A1单元格输入"=B1+C1"后若再输入"=D1E1",系统将直接替换原有公式而非生成"=B1+C1+D1E1"的效果。

       单元格引用机制的局限性

       电子表格中的单元格具有唯一地址标识,这种寻址方式决定了其无法同时承载多个独立公式。当使用者需要合并不同公式的计算结果时,必须通过函数嵌套或辅助列实现。例如需要同时计算销售额总和与平均值时,正确做法是在B1单元格输入"=SUM(A:A)",在B2单元格输入"=AVERAGE(A:A)",而非试图在同一个单元格叠加两个公式。根据微软官方文档说明,这种设计能有效避免计算循环和内存溢出问题。

       函数嵌套的合理应用

       通过函数嵌套可以实现多步骤计算的集成,但需注意嵌套层数限制。以最新版本电子表格软件为例,允许最多64层嵌套函数,这为复杂计算提供了可行性。例如需要先筛选大于100的数值再求和时,应使用"=SUMIF(A:A,">100")"而非先单独筛选再求和。实际案例中,某企业财务人员试图在同一个单元格叠加增值税计算和折扣计算公式,导致结果错误,改为使用"=原价(1-折扣率)税率"的嵌套公式后问题得解。

       运算符优先级的干扰

       不同运算符具有特定计算优先级,贸然叠加公式可能导致运算顺序混乱。乘除法优先于加减法的规则常被忽视,例如输入"=A1+B1C1"与"=A1+B1""C1"将产生截然不同的结果。某物流公司曾在运费计算中出现重大误差,其根源就是在同一个单元格混用了不同优先级的运算符而未添加括号。正确做法应当使用"=(A1+B1)C1"或"=A1+(B1C1)"明确运算顺序。

       循环引用的检测机制

       电子表格软件设有完善的循环引用检测系统,当公式间接或直接引用自身时会自动拦截。这种保护机制客观上阻止了公式的随意叠加。例如在A1单元格输入"=A1+B1"时,系统会立即提示循环引用错误。某上市公司财务报表中出现过典型案例:财务人员试图在利润单元格叠加计算公式和校验公式,触发循环引用警告后,通过拆分计算步骤到不同单元格得以解决。

       数据类型兼容性问题

       不同公式返回的数据类型可能存在冲突,强行叠加会导致计算错误。文本函数与数学函数的混合使用是常见雷区,例如"=LEFT(A1,2)+RIGHT(B1,3)"在包含非数字字符时必然报错。某零售企业库存管理系统曾因在同一个单元格混合文本提取和数值计算公式,导致库存数量统计失效。解决方案是分别使用"=VALUE(LEFT(A1,2))"和"=VALUE(RIGHT(B1,3))"确保数据类型一致后再相加。

       数组公式的特殊性

       现代电子表格软件支持数组公式,但其计算逻辑与普通公式存在显著差异。数组公式要求所有参与运算的区域保持维度一致,且需按特定组合键完成输入。例如需要同时计算多列数据之和时,应使用"=SUM(A1:A10B1:B10)"的数组公式形式,而非分别求和再叠加。某科研机构处理实验数据时,通过正确使用数组公式将原本需要10个辅助列的计算合并到单个单元格,大幅提升了工作效率。

       条件格式的冲突规避

       条件格式规则与单元格公式共享计算资源,叠加使用可能引发显示异常。每个单元格最多可设置64个条件格式规则,但规则之间可能存在互斥。例如某人力资源表同时设置"工资>10000显示红色"和"工龄<5显示黄色"时,若两个条件同时满足会出现规则竞争。专业做法是通过"=AND(工资>10000,工龄<5)"的复合条件统一管理显示逻辑。

       易失性函数的资源占用

       易失性函数(如NOW、RAND等)每次重算都会刷新结果,过多叠加将显著影响性能。某证券公司交易系统曾因在关键单元格叠加多个易失性函数导致刷新卡顿。最佳实践是将易失性函数集中在专用单元格,其他公式通过引用的方式获取结果。例如在A1输入"=NOW()",后续所有需要时间戳的公式统一引用A1而非重复使用NOW函数。

       错误传递的连锁反应

       公式链中单个单元格的错误会产生扩散效应,叠加公式会加大排查难度。电子表格软件虽然提供错误追踪工具,但复合公式的调试尤为复杂。某制造业成本核算案例显示,原本简单的除法错误因与其他公式叠加,导致最终偏差放大300倍。建议采用分步计算模式,在每个关键节点设置误差检验公式,而非将所有计算压缩到单个单元格。

       跨表引用的性能瓶颈

       引用其他工作表数据时,公式叠加会加剧计算延迟。特别是使用闭式外部引用时,每次刷新都需要遍历多个文件。某集团公司合并报表系统优化案例表明,将跨表引用公式分解到辅助列后,计算速度提升约40%。对于必须使用跨表引用的场景,建议通过Power Query(数据查询工具)进行数据预处理。

       保护机制的操作限制

       工作表保护功能会阻止公式修改,这在协作环境中有效防止了公式被意外叠加。某共享预算表的审计轨迹显示,启用保护后公式错误率下降约75%。需要注意的是,保护密码需由管理员统一管理,同时要为合法修改预留审核通道。

       版本兼容性的考量

       不同版本电子表格软件对公式的处理存在差异,叠加公式可能引发兼容问题。某企业将包含新版本动态数组公式的文件发往使用旧版本的分支机构时,出现大面积显示异常。解决方案是通过"文件-信息-检查问题-检查兼容性"功能提前检测,或改用传统数组公式写法。

       计算模式的设置影响

       手动计算模式下,叠加公式可能造成数据更新不同步。某期货交易模型曾因忽略计算模式设置,导致风险指标计算滞后。重要模型建议设置为自动计算,或在使用前强制进行全表重算(按F9键)。

       内存管理的技术约束

       电子表格软件为每个单元格分配固定内存空间,叠加复杂公式可能触发内存溢出。某地质研究所处理大型矩阵运算时,通过将复合公式拆解为多个简单步骤,成功避免了系统崩溃。对于超大规模计算,建议迁移到专业数学软件处理。

       最佳实践的解决方案

       建立规范的公式编写标准能有效避免叠加问题。某跨国企业实施的"单单元格单功能"原则要求:每个单元格仅承担一个计算目标,复杂运算通过辅助列分步实现。配合版本控制工具,使表格错误率下降约90%。同时推荐使用LAMBDA(自定义函数)封装常用计算逻辑,提升公式的可复用性。

       通过系统化理解电子表格公式的运行机制,使用者可以更科学地规划计算结构。实际上公式不叠加的特性正是软件稳定性的重要保障,掌握正确的多公式集成方法,反而能发挥出电子表格更强大的数据处理能力。建议在日常使用中养成定期审核公式依赖关系的习惯,利用软件自带的公式审核工具优化计算流程。

相关文章
excel恢复命令恢复什么
本文将详细解析电子表格软件中的恢复功能具体能恢复哪些内容,涵盖十二个常见数据恢复场景,包括未保存文档、误删工作表、格式化数据、覆盖内容等典型案例,并附带实际操作演示说明。
2025-11-01 04:22:54
32人看过
excel 工程单位是什么单位
工程单位是电子表格软件中用于控制单元格行高列宽的特殊计量体系,它既不同于像素也不属于物理尺寸单位,而是基于字符宽度的相对衡量标准。本文将系统解析其定义原理、换算方法及实际应用场景,帮助用户精准掌控表格布局。
2025-11-01 04:22:12
126人看过
excel的组成包括什么作用
本文详细解析表格处理软件的十二个核心组成部分及其功能,从基础单元格到高级数据工具,通过实际案例阐述每个组件在数据处理、分析和可视化中的关键作用,帮助用户全面提升办公效率。
2025-11-01 04:22:08
341人看过
word中域指的是什么
在文字处理软件中,"域"是一个承载动态数据的特殊指令集。它如同文档中的智能模块,能够自动生成页码、更新交叉引用、实现邮件合并等高级功能。本文将通过十二个核心维度系统解析域的概念体系,涵盖基础分类、操作方法和实际应用场景,帮助用户掌握这项提升文档自动化水平的关键技术。
2025-11-01 04:22:01
271人看过
word什么是天淡黑色
本文将深入解析文字处理软件中“天淡黑色”这一特殊色彩概念。文章从色彩理论、软件实现、设计应用等十二个维度展开探讨,结合官方文档与实操案例,详细说明这种介于深灰与纯黑之间的中性色在文档排版、视觉设计中的独特价值与实用技巧。
2025-11-01 04:21:51
142人看过
用什么软件可以朗读word
本文系统梳理十二类适用于微软Word文档朗读的实用工具,涵盖操作系统内置功能、办公软件原生组件、专业辅助技术方案及多平台适配应用。通过分析各类工具的操作逻辑与适用场景,结合具体操作案例演示,帮助视觉障碍用户、多任务处理者及内容校对人员高效实现文本语音转换。文章重点解析工具配置要点与性能差异,提供跨设备协同工作的解决方案。
2025-11-01 04:21:42
205人看过